Quick summary

To bring your cooking passion to life with your perfect kitchen, start by investing in good lighting and smart appliances, which can cost around £1,000 to £5,000 for a typical renovation. Adding skylights or under-cabinet lights enhances atmosphere and functionality, while smart ovens and high-tech extractors improve convenience. Organisation solutions and a large island for entertaining complete the setup, depending on your space and budget.

Choose skylights for natural light

If you want to make the most of daylight hours for your cooking adventures, natural light will be your saving grace. Installing skylights in your kitchen is a fantastic way to bring natural light in, meaning you can see more, soak up those all-important sun rays and save money on electricity bills at the same time. Skylights come in a huge array of shapes and sizes, so you’ll find one that fits perfectly in your kitchen.
